The Six Sigma Fallacy in IT




"Six Sigma" was originally created for manufacturing, to eliminate defects.

The original proponents, like GE, never applied it to the engineering and design depts, where innovation and original thinking were required to create.

That's the big fallacy in applying it to software—what developers do is engineering.  The equivalent of "manufacturing" in software is "copy" or "cut and paste", which don't have defects.
